** ### Common Questions People Have About The Williamson County Sheriff's Office: A Commitment to Safety**

What are the primary responsibilities of the Williamson County Sheriff's Office?

The office handles a wide range of duties essential to public safety. These include patrolling county roads, operating the county jail, serving legal documents, and investigating crimes. They also provide support for traffic management and emergency situations. This comprehensive set of tasks ensures that the community is protected from various threats. Understanding these roles helps residents appreciate the scope of their daily work.

** Things People Often Misunderstand

A common misconception is that local sheriff's offices are solely focused on dramatic crime response. In reality, a large portion of their work involves prevention and routine community interaction. Officers spend significant time on traffic stops, administrative tasks, and non-emergency calls. Another misunderstanding is that all local agencies operate identically. Each county has its own unique demographics, challenges, and priorities that shape its approach. Recognizing these nuances helps the public view their sheriff's office as a complex and adaptive organization rather than a monolithic entity.
